January 2012 Registration

Pre Health Checks for all participants •Weight•Blood pressure•2 questions about nutrition and activity

What’s Involved?

January through June 2012

Communities will earn points by:•Participating in scheduled programs that support healthy eating and physical activity•Implement programs with partners that support healthy eating and physical activity•Establish policies to support healthy eating and physical activity

What’s Involved?

June 2012 Challenge Finale

Post Health Checks for all participants •Weight•Blood pressure•2 questions about nutrition and activity

Community tabulation of points earned for participation and policies.

What’s Involved?

“Healthiest Community” Greatest percentage of weight loss and the highest number of points earned through programs, policies and participation

Reward:$2000 and plaque or trophy
